> > Unfortunately I am now faced with a dilemma. My typical first actions
> > when putting together a fresh server is to add ATRpms to yum repos,
> > install apt via yum, then add the atrpms repo to the apt sources.list. 
> > 
> > Since I skipped atrpms during the recent install of a server, I am faced
> > with installing atrpm's apt after centos's. I am currently faced with
> > the below problem, and a bit afraid to go further:
> > 
> > # apt-get install apt
> > Reading Package Lists... Done
> > Building Dependency Tree... Done
> > The following extra packages will be installed:
> >   libbeecrypt6 librpm4.4 neon popt pythonabi rpm rpm-python
> > The following packages will be upgraded
> >   apt popt rpm rpm-python
> > The following packages will be REPLACED:
> >   rpm-libs (by librpm4.4)
> > The following NEW packages will be installed:
> >   libbeecrypt6 librpm4.4 neon pythonabi
> > 4 upgraded, 4 newly installed, 1 replaced, 0 removed and 10 not
> > upgraded.
> > Need to get 0B/3155kB of archives.
> > After unpacking 1309kB of additional disk space will be used.
> > Do you want to continue? [Y/n]  
> > Committing changes...
> > Preparing...                ###########################################
> > [100%]
> >         file /usr/lib/libbeecrypt.so.6 from install of
> > libbeecrypt6-4.1.2-10.1_14.el4.at conflicts with file from package
> > beecrypt-3.1.0-6
> > E: Error while running transaction
> > 
> > All packages so far have been installed via centos' official
> > repositories. Is there a "safe" way across this?
> 
> Compatibility between CentOS/Scientific Linux/other clones
> etc. with3rd party repos is something we work on. For now just make a
> choice and stick with it.
